The Ardmore Open was a golf tournament on the PGA Tour from 1952 to 1954. It was played at Dornick Hills Golf and Country Club in Ardmore, Oklahoma.

Winners

*1954 Julius Boros
*1953 Earl Stewart
*1952 Dave Douglas
